Description: Parry Wood is a small, level, and accessible wood, part of Wern Brake woodland, with spectacular views to the south. It is well located for the M4, with views across the Severn estuary.
The wood has some mature trees, but mainly consists of young broadleaves. The western side is designated as Ancient Semi-natural Woodland, while the remainder is ‘Ancient Woodland of unknown category’.
Access: the wood adjoins the public highway, but the main access is over a right of way through a gate, and over a good woodland track. There is a stoned hard-standing within the wood itself, suitable for use by an ordinary car.
Shelter: there is a small tool shed in the wood, on the southern boundary.
Boundaries: the southern boundary is fenced from adjoining farmland . The eastern and north-western boundaries are marked with stakes, further marked with blue paint. The northern boundary is formed by the main access track within the wood. The short south-western boundary is the road.
Sporting rights: Included.
Mineral rights: Included
Local area: Parry Wood is located 6 miles north of the M4 at Magor, and 9 miles from the Old Severn Bridge, 13 miles from Newport, and 24 miles from the centre of Bristol.
Gray Hill, with views over Wentwood (the largest area of ancient forest in Wales) and the Severn Estuary is just two miles away.
